Synopses & ReviewsPublisher Comments:In Corporateering, Jamie Court illustrates how corporations routinely and quietly rob us of our personal freedoms, in-cluding privacy, security, the right to legal recourse, and more. In fact, "corporateering"-the act of prioritizing commercial gain over individual, social, or cultural gain-is everywhere in our lives. Court offers empowering strategies for counter- corporateering so we can reclaim our private lives, our right to health and safety, and other personal liberties.
About the AuthorJamie Court is the executive director of the Foundation for Taxpayer and Consumer Rights in Santa Monica, California. He has helped to pioneer patients' rights laws in states across the country.
